Accepting request 1128665 from home:RMestre:branches:Java:packages
- replace prep setup and patches macro with autosetup OBS-URL: https://build.opensuse.org/request/show/1128665 OBS-URL: https://build.opensuse.org/package/show/Java:packages/tomcat?expand=0&rev=281
This commit is contained in:
parent
0e5a696eed
commit
6c8547a641
@ -1,5 +1,7 @@
|
|||||||
--- res/META-INF/bootstrap.jar.manifest.orig 2010-04-06 10:11:09.000000000 -0600
|
Index: apache-tomcat-9.0.82-src/res/META-INF/bootstrap.jar.manifest
|
||||||
+++ res/META-INF/bootstrap.jar.manifest 2010-04-06 10:45:56.000000000 -0600
|
===================================================================
|
||||||
|
--- apache-tomcat-9.0.82-src.orig/res/META-INF/bootstrap.jar.manifest
|
||||||
|
+++ apache-tomcat-9.0.82-src/res/META-INF/bootstrap.jar.manifest
|
||||||
@@ -1,6 +1,5 @@
|
@@ -1,6 +1,5 @@
|
||||||
Manifest-Version: 1.0
|
Manifest-Version: 1.0
|
||||||
Main-Class: org.apache.catalina.startup.Bootstrap
|
Main-Class: org.apache.catalina.startup.Bootstrap
|
||||||
|
@ -1,8 +1,8 @@
|
|||||||
Index: conf/catalina.policy
|
Index: apache-tomcat-9.0.82-src/conf/catalina.policy
|
||||||
===================================================================
|
===================================================================
|
||||||
--- conf/catalina.policy.orig
|
--- apache-tomcat-9.0.82-src.orig/conf/catalina.policy
|
||||||
+++ conf/catalina.policy
|
+++ apache-tomcat-9.0.82-src/conf/catalina.policy
|
||||||
@@ -167,6 +167,9 @@ grant {
|
@@ -171,6 +171,9 @@ grant {
|
||||||
permission java.lang.RuntimePermission "accessClassInPackage.org.apache.tomcat";
|
permission java.lang.RuntimePermission "accessClassInPackage.org.apache.tomcat";
|
||||||
|
|
||||||
// Precompiled JSPs need access to these packages.
|
// Precompiled JSPs need access to these packages.
|
||||||
@ -12,7 +12,7 @@ Index: conf/catalina.policy
|
|||||||
permission java.lang.RuntimePermission "accessClassInPackage.org.apache.jasper.el";
|
permission java.lang.RuntimePermission "accessClassInPackage.org.apache.jasper.el";
|
||||||
permission java.lang.RuntimePermission "accessClassInPackage.org.apache.jasper.runtime";
|
permission java.lang.RuntimePermission "accessClassInPackage.org.apache.jasper.runtime";
|
||||||
permission java.lang.RuntimePermission
|
permission java.lang.RuntimePermission
|
||||||
@@ -216,6 +219,15 @@ grant codeBase "file:${catalina.home}/we
|
@@ -220,6 +223,15 @@ grant codeBase "file:${catalina.home}/we
|
||||||
};
|
};
|
||||||
|
|
||||||
|
|
||||||
|
@ -1,8 +1,8 @@
|
|||||||
Index: conf/tomcat-users.xml
|
Index: apache-tomcat-9.0.82-src/conf/tomcat-users.xml
|
||||||
===================================================================
|
===================================================================
|
||||||
--- conf/tomcat-users.xml.orig
|
--- apache-tomcat-9.0.82-src.orig/conf/tomcat-users.xml
|
||||||
+++ conf/tomcat-users.xml
|
+++ apache-tomcat-9.0.82-src/conf/tomcat-users.xml
|
||||||
@@ -41,4 +41,14 @@
|
@@ -53,4 +53,14 @@
|
||||||
<user username="both" password="<must-be-changed>" roles="tomcat,role1"/>
|
<user username="both" password="<must-be-changed>" roles="tomcat,role1"/>
|
||||||
<user username="role1" password="<must-be-changed>" roles="role1"/>
|
<user username="role1" password="<must-be-changed>" roles="role1"/>
|
||||||
-->
|
-->
|
||||||
|
@ -1,3 +1,8 @@
|
|||||||
|
-------------------------------------------------------------------
|
||||||
|
Thu Nov 23 12:32:49 UTC 2023 - Ricardo Mestre <ricardo.mestre@suse.com>
|
||||||
|
|
||||||
|
- replace prep setup and patches macro with autosetup
|
||||||
|
|
||||||
-------------------------------------------------------------------
|
-------------------------------------------------------------------
|
||||||
Fri Oct 13 11:12:07 UTC 2023 - Fridrich Strba <fstrba@suse.com>
|
Fri Oct 13 11:12:07 UTC 2023 - Fridrich Strba <fstrba@suse.com>
|
||||||
|
|
||||||
|
11
tomcat.spec
11
tomcat.spec
@ -241,20 +241,11 @@ Requires: jakarta-taglibs-standard >= 1.1
|
|||||||
The ROOT and examples web applications for Apache Tomcat
|
The ROOT and examples web applications for Apache Tomcat
|
||||||
|
|
||||||
%prep
|
%prep
|
||||||
%setup -q -n %{packdname} -b33
|
%autosetup -p1 -n %{packdname} -b 33
|
||||||
|
|
||||||
# remove pre-built binaries and windows files
|
# remove pre-built binaries and windows files
|
||||||
find . -type f \( -name "*.bat" -o -name "*.class" -o -name Thumbs.db -o -name "*.gz" -o \
|
find . -type f \( -name "*.bat" -o -name "*.class" -o -name Thumbs.db -o -name "*.gz" -o \
|
||||||
-name "*.jar" -o -name "*.war" -o -name "*.zip" \) -print -delete
|
-name "*.jar" -o -name "*.war" -o -name "*.zip" \) -print -delete
|
||||||
%patch0
|
|
||||||
%patch1
|
|
||||||
%patch2
|
|
||||||
%patch3 -p1
|
|
||||||
%patch4 -p1
|
|
||||||
%patch5 -p1
|
|
||||||
%patch6 -p1
|
|
||||||
%patch7 -p1
|
|
||||||
%patch8 -p1
|
|
||||||
|
|
||||||
# remove date from docs
|
# remove date from docs
|
||||||
sed -i -e '/build-date/ d' webapps/docs/tomcat-docs.xsl
|
sed -i -e '/build-date/ d' webapps/docs/tomcat-docs.xsl
|
||||||
|
Loading…
x
Reference in New Issue
Block a user